- // Enumerate failures for histogramming purposes. DO NOT CHANGE THE
- // ORDERING OF THESE VALUES.
- // TODO(kcarattini): Use a custom v4 histogram set.
- enum ResultType {
- // 200 response code means that the server recognized the hash
- // prefix, while 204 is an empty response indicating that the
- // server did not recognize it.
- GET_HASH_STATUS_200,
- GET_HASH_STATUS_204,
-
- // Subset of successful responses which returned no full hashes.
- // This includes the STATUS_204 case, and the *_ERROR cases.
- GET_HASH_FULL_HASH_EMPTY,
-
- // Subset of successful responses for which one or more of the
- // full hashes matched (should lead to an interstitial).
- GET_HASH_FULL_HASH_HIT,
-
- // Subset of successful responses which weren't empty and have no
- // matches. It means that there was a prefix collision which was
- // cleared up by the full hashes.
- GET_HASH_FULL_HASH_MISS,
-
- // Subset of successful responses where the response body wasn't parsable.
- GET_HASH_PARSE_ERROR,
-
- // Gethash request failed (network error).
- GET_HASH_NETWORK_ERROR,
-
- // Gethash request returned HTTP result code other than 200 or 204.
- GET_HASH_HTTP_ERROR,
-
- // Gethash attempted during error backoff, no request sent.
- GET_HASH_BACKOFF_ERROR,
-
- // Gethash attempted before min wait duration elapsed, no request sent.
- GET_HASH_MIN_WAIT_DURATION_ERROR,
-
- // Memory space for histograms is determined by the max. ALWAYS
- // ADD NEW VALUES BEFORE THIS ONE.
- GET_HASH_RESULT_MAX
- };
